A sensitive adaptation of the emotional core of Massenet's work, utilizing the piano's range to evoke the introspective nature of the protagonist. It focuses on sustain and tone production rather than mere virtuosic display.
The performer must sustain long, melancholic phrases without losing energy or momentum through the transition points.

Bouquet de mélodies sur 'Werther' is rated Henle level 5 of 9 — late intermediate repertoire, roughly ABRSM grades 6–7. In the RCM system it corresponds to about level 7.
You should be comfortable at Henle level 5 — meaning you can already play level 4–5 pieces cleanly. Learning it one level early is possible as a stretch piece, but more than that usually leads to months of frustration.
A typical performance of Bouquet de mélodies sur 'Werther' lasts about 6 minutes.
